My engine loses power when I increase the RPM's. I can hold the choke in and it will accelerate to speed.<br />I have replaced the diaphram and spark plugs. I have also cleaned the carbs.<br />It idles and starts great and I can troll all day.

What diaphram did you replace, Gene?<br /><br />You have obvious fuel starvation.<br /><br />Look for restrictions in fuel tank vent and pickup, restrictions or air leaks in fuel lines and primer bulb.<br /><br />Your fuel pump may be weak.<br /><br />Your carbs may be set up incorrectly.<br /><br />Finally, you may have an air leak to the crankcase via a bad gasket.<br /><br />Good luck. :)

Not sure when they stopped using the foam hood liner but I have an older motor that was getting microscopic bits of the foam hood liner in the carb bowl vents and would get up in the main jets and cause lean condition. Yet if I stopped to work on it or check out things it would be fine agin till they started plugging off the jets again. Once I removed the foam and cleaned the float bowls again have not had that problem again.
